Frequently Asked Questions about Powder Springs
How much are Studio apartments in Powder Springs?
There are currently 2 Studio Apartments in Powder Springs with rent ranges from $1,399 to $1,624 with an average price of $1,524.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Powder Springs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Powder Springs ranges from $732 to $3,041 with an average monthly rent of $1,637.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Powder Springs c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Powder Springs range from $1,170 to $3,368.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,843.
How expensive are Powder Springs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 28 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Powder Springs on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,376 to $4,640 - averaging $2,114 for the location.
